Why a heat pump makes sense for Union City homes

Union City has a Mediterranean climate with mild, wet winters and warm, dry summers. That means most homes need modest heating in winter and reliable cooling in summer. Heat pumps provide both heating and cooling with much higher efficiency than traditional electric resistance or older gas systems. In local terms, a properly sized heat pump can lower monthly energy use during both peak summer and cooler months, improve indoor comfort in multi-zone homes, and support local decarbonization goals tied to California energy policies.

Common heat pump types and which suit Union City

  • Air-source heat pumps: The most common choice for single-family homes and townhouses. Efficient, cost-effective, and well suited to Union City’s climate. Newer models operate efficiently at cooler temperatures and provide strong cooling performance in summer.
  • Ductless mini-splits: Ideal for older Union City homes without ductwork, for add-on rooms, or to create separate climate zones (bedrooms, home offices). They offer targeted comfort and avoid costly ductwork modification.
  • Central heat pumps (forced air): Use existing ducts and are a practical upgrade when ductwork is in good condition. Performance depends strongly on duct sealing and insulation.
  • Ground-source (geothermal) heat pumps: Highly efficient but typically higher upfront cost and more site-dependent. Best on larger lots where installation disturbance and bore field space are feasible.

Site assessment and load calculations

A professional installation begins with a detailed site assessment and Manual J load calculation tailored to Union City homes. Key steps include:

  • Inspecting the building envelope: wall, attic, and slab insulation levels; window types; and air leakage.
  • Measuring conditioned area and layout: single-zone vs multi-zone needs, ceiling heights, and orientation.
  • Evaluating existing ductwork: leakage, insulation, and sizing for central systems.
  • Considering occupant patterns and internal heat gains from appliances or electronics.

Load calculations determine the correct heat pump capacity. Oversizing leads to short cycling, humidity control problems, and inefficient operation—common issues in retrofit projects if load calculations are skipped.

Choosing the right system and equipment

Selection is driven by the load calculation, comfort goals, and site constraints. Important considerations:

  • Efficiency ratings: look at HSPF and SEER2 values for heating and cooling performance. Higher ratings deliver better long-term savings.
  • Modulation and variable-speed compressors: improve comfort by matching output to demand and reducing noise.
  • Multi-zone capability: useful for larger Union City homes or rooms with different occupancy patterns.
  • Compatibility with existing heat distribution: works with forced-air ducts or as ductless systems where ducts are absent.

Professional installation steps

Professional installation follows a structured process to ensure reliability and compliance:

  1. Pre-install preparation: finalize equipment selection, obtain permits, and schedule disconnects for existing equipment if needed.
  2. Site preparation: create level pads for outdoor units, secure mounting for indoor units, and plan route for refrigerant lines and condensate drain.
  3. Mechanical installation: mount indoor and outdoor units, install refrigerant piping, electrical connections, condensate drainage, and any necessary duct modifications.
  4. Controls and thermostat: install and configure controls, including smart thermostats or zoning controls that enhance efficiency.
  5. Inspections and permitting: submit for local building inspection and ensure installation meets California Title 24 energy code and Union City/Alameda County requirements.

Permitting, code compliance, and inspections

Heat pump installations in Union City must comply with state and local codes, including California energy standards (Title 24) and local building and electrical codes. Permit requirements typically cover mechanical, electrical, and refrigeration work. Inspections ensure safe electrical connections, correct refrigerant handling, and proper equipment mounting. Proper permitting also preserves eligibility for certain rebates and incentives.

Commissioning and performance testing

Commissioning verifies the system operates as designed. Standard tests include:

  • Refrigerant charge and leak check to ensure correct pressure and efficiency.
  • Airflow measurements and balancing for ducted systems to confirm distribution matches design.
  • Electrical load and startup current checks to verify safe operation.
  • Thermostat calibration and zone checks so setpoints deliver expected comfort.
  • Noise and vibration checks, especially important where outdoor units sit near neighbors or patios.

Documented commissioning provides baseline performance data and helps diagnose early issues.

Expected efficiency, comfort benefits, and common issues

Benefits you can expect in Union City homes:

  • Better year-round comfort with precise temperature control and improved humidity handling.
  • Lower energy use compared with electric resistance heating and competitive performance versus gas furnaces depending on system efficiency and energy rates.
  • Quieter operation and reduced maintenance compared with older systems.

Common issues to watch for:

  • Incorrect sizing that causes short cycling or inadequate dehumidification.
  • Poor ductwork contributing to uneven comfort and energy loss.
  • Improper refrigerant charge or airflow leading to decreased efficiency and higher energy bills.
  • Placement problems for outdoor units causing noise or airflow restrictions.

A careful site assessment, properly executed installation, and commissioning reduce these risks substantially.

Rebates and incentives guidance for Union City homeowners

Union City residents often qualify for federal, state, and utility incentives that lower net installation costs. Typical paths include:

  • Federal tax credits for qualifying high-efficiency heat pumps when standards are met.
  • State-level incentives tied to California energy efficiency programs.
  • Local utility rebates or performance-based incentives managed through energy providers or regional programs.

Eligibility depends on equipment specifications and installation quality. Keep records of equipment model numbers, efficiency ratings, and permit/inspection documentation to support rebate applications.

Maintenance to preserve efficiency and longevity

Routine maintenance keeps a heat pump performing at peak levels:

  • Replace or clean filters regularly (every 1 to 3 months depending on use).
  • Keep outdoor units clear of debris, landscaping, and shade obstructions to maintain airflow.
  • Schedule annual professional tune-ups to check refrigerant charge, electrical connections, and compressor health.
  • For ducted systems, inspect and seal ducts and check insulation in attics or crawlspaces.

Regular maintenance prevents common failures and helps maintain warranty coverage.
